Unique Selling Proposition (USP)
At its core, Near NEAR's primary USP lies in its groundbreaking scalability and usability features. The platform utilizes a unique sharding technology called "Nightshade," which enables it to process millions of transactions per second with minimal fees. Additionally, Near NEAR has prioritized developer-friendliness by offering familiar programming environments, comprehensive documentation, and seamless onboarding processes. This combination of high performance and accessibility sets Near NEAR apart from competitors.
Target Audience
Near NEAR targets a diverse range of users, including blockchain developers, enterprises seeking decentralized solutions, and everyday users interested in privacy and security. Developers are attracted to its simplified smart contract development using familiar languages like Rust and AssemblyScript. Enterprises explore Near NEAR for decentralized finance (DeFi), supply chain management, and digital identity applications. Meanwhile, crypto enthusiasts and casual users appreciate its intuitive interface and low transaction costs, making it suitable for onboarding a broader population into the blockchain space.

Cosmos ATOM
Introduction to Cosmos ATOM: The Internet of Blockchains
Cosmos ATOM is a prominent cryptocurrency and blockchain platform that aims to create an interconnected ecosystem of independent blockchains, often referred to as the "Internet of Blockchains." Launched in 2019 by the Cosmos Network, ATOM serves as both a native staking token and a governance asset. Its mission is to facilitate seamless communication and interoperability between diverse blockchain networks, overcoming the limitations of isolated systems. As blockchain technology matures, Cosmos has positioned itself as a significant player in the quest for a more scalable, flexible, and interconnected decentralized ecosystem.
Technical Fundamentals: Blockchain, Cryptography, and Smart Contracts
At its core, Cosmos is built upon robust blockchain technology that emphasizes scalability and modularity. Its unique framework, the Tendermint consensus algorithm, provides fast finality and security, enabling rapid transaction processing while maintaining decentralization. Tendermint combines Byzantine Fault Tolerance (BFT) with a Proof-of-Stake (PoS) mechanism to ensure blockchain integrity even in the presence of malicious actors.
Cryptography plays a vital role in securing transactions and network integrity. Cosmos leverages elliptic curve cryptography (ECC) for digital signatures and transaction validation, ensuring secure and verifiable exchanges. Additionally, zero-knowledge proofs and other cryptographic innovations are being explored to enhance privacy and scalability.
While Cosmos does not natively support a comprehensive smart contract platform like Ethereum, it employs the Cosmos SDK, a modular framework that allows developers to build custom blockchains with specific functionalities. Some projects within the Cosmos ecosystem, such as the Cosmos Hub, can interact with smart contract platforms like Ethermint, which extends compatibility with Ethereum’s virtual machine (EVM). This interoperability is a cornerstone of Cosmos’s vision for decentralized ecosystems.
Applied Aspects of Cosmos ATOM: Payments, DeFi, Regulation, and Security
Payments and Transactions: Cosmos ATOM can be used for simple payments and transaction settlements within its ecosystem. Its high throughput and low latency make it suitable for real-time applications, with transaction fees remaining competitive compared to other blockchain networks.
Decentralized Finance (DeFi): The Cosmos ecosystem hosts various DeFi protocols, including decentralized exchanges (DEXs), lending platforms, and yield farming projects. Interoperability enables smooth asset transfers across different chains, expanding the DeFi ecosystem’s potential. Platform projects like Gravity DEX and Osmosis exemplify Cosmos’s commitment to DeFi innovation.
Regulation and Compliance: As blockchain adoption grows, regulatory considerations are vital. Cosmos advocates for compliance by enabling identity verification and KYC processes integrated into its governance structures. However, the decentralized nature of Cosmos poses ongoing challenges in establishing legal frameworks that balance innovation and security.
Security Aspects: Security in Cosmos is anchored in its PoS consensus, with ATOM holders participating in staking activities that secure the network and earn rewards. The interoperability feature is secured through the IBC (Inter-Blockchain Communication) protocol, designed with cryptographic validation to prevent fraud and ensure trustless exchanges among chains. Continuous upgrades and community oversight maintain the network’s resilience against attacks.
